[0026] 为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对照附图说明本发明的具体实施方式。显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图,并获得其他的实施方式。
[0027] 为使图面简洁,各图中只示意性地表示出了与本发明相关的部分,它们并不代表其作为产品的实际结构。另外,以使图面简洁便于理解,在有些图中具有相同结构或功能的部件,仅示意性地绘示了其中的一个,或仅标出了其中的一个。在本文中,“一个”不仅表示“仅此一个”,也可以表示“多于一个”的情形。
[0028] 图1是本发明一种基于移动终端的门锁控制方法的流程示意图。如图1所示,根据本发明的一个实施例,一种基于移动终端的门锁控制方法,包括:
[0029] 步骤S10解析用户的上传操作,利用第一网络和第二网络分别传输开锁数据,所述开锁数据包括含有用户运动轨迹的地图图片和上传所述开锁数据的移动终端所对应的特征信息;优选的,所述第一网络为移动网络或WIFI无线网络;所述第二网络为蓝牙无线网络或红外无线网络;
[0030] 步骤S20根据分别接收到的开锁数据,判断所述地图图片中的用户运动轨迹是否相同;
[0031] 步骤S30若所述地图图片中的用户运动轨迹相同,则发送门锁开启指令;
[0032] 步骤S31若所述地图图片中的用户运动轨迹不同,则放弃发送门锁开启指令;
[0033] 步骤S50根据已发送的门锁开启指令,执行门锁开启操作。
[0034] 图2是本发明一种基于移动终端的门锁控制方法的流程示意图。如图2所示,根据本发明的一个实施例,一种基于移动终端的门锁控制方法,包括:
[0035] 步骤S01至少预设用户运动轨迹所经过的一个地理位置,例如:公司所在的地理位置、家附近的某个超市所在的地理位置;
[0036] 步骤S10解析用户的上传操作,利用第一网络和第二网络分别传输开锁数据,所述开锁数据包括含有用户运动轨迹的地图图片和上传所述开锁数据的移动终端所对应的特征信息;优选的,所述第一网络为移动网络或WIFI无线网络;所述第二网络为蓝牙无线网络或红外无线网络;
[0037] 步骤S20根据分别接收到的开锁数据,判断所述地图图片中的用户运动轨迹是否相同;
[0038] 步骤S21若所述地图图片中的用户运动轨迹相同,则进一步判断所述地图图片中的用户运动轨迹是否经过预设地理位置;否则,放弃发送门锁开启指令;
[0039] 步骤S30若所述地图图片中的用户运动轨迹经过预设地理位置,则发送门锁开启指令;
[0040] 步骤S31若所述地图图片中的用户运动轨迹不同,则放弃发送门锁开启指令;
[0041] 步骤S50根据已发送的门锁开启指令,执行门锁开启操作。
[0042] 图3是本发明一种基于移动终端的门锁控制方法的流程示意图。如图3所示,根据本发明的一个实施例,一种基于移动终端的门锁控制方法,包括:
[0043] 步骤S01预设移动终端所对应的特征信息,例如手机的识别码(手机IMEI号);
[0044] 步骤S10解析用户的上传操作,利用第一网络和第二网络分别传输开锁数据,所述开锁数据包括含有用户运动轨迹的地图图片和上传所述开锁数据的移动终端所对应的特征信息;优选的,所述第一网络为移动网络或WIFI无线网络;所述第二网络为蓝牙无线网络或红外无线网络;
[0045] 步骤S20根据分别接收到的开锁数据,判断所述地图图片中的用户运动轨迹是否相同;
[0046] 优选的,还包括步骤S21若所述地图图片中的用户运动轨迹相同,则进一步判断所述地图图片中的用户运动轨迹是否经过预设地理位置;否则,放弃发送门锁开启指令;
[0047] 步骤S30若所述地图图片中的用户运动轨迹经过预设地理位置,则发送门锁开启指令;
[0048] 步骤S31若所述地图图片中的用户运动轨迹不同,则放弃发送门锁开启指令;
[0049] 步骤S40根据分别接收到的开锁数据,判断所述开锁数据中的特征信息与预设移动终端所对应的特征信息是否相同;
[0050] 步骤S41若所述开锁数据中的特征信息与预设移动终端所对应的特征信息相同,则跳转至步骤S50;否则,结束开锁过程;
[0051] 步骤S50根据已发送的门锁开启指令,执行门锁开启操作。
[0052] 图4是本发明一种基于移动终端的门锁控制方法的流程示意图。如图4所示,根据本发明的一个实施例,一种基于移动终端的门锁控制方法,包括:
[0053] 步骤S02解析用户的操作,采集记录含有用户运动轨迹的地图图片;
[0054] 优选的,还包括步骤S03获取上传所述开锁数据的移动终端所对应的特征信息;
[0055] 步骤S10解析用户的上传操作,利用第一网络和第二网络分别传输开锁数据,所述开锁数据包括含有用户运动轨迹的地图图片和上传所述开锁数据的移动终端所对应的特征信息;优选的,所述第一网络为移动网络或WIFI无线网络;所述第二网络为蓝牙无线网络或红外无线网络;
[0056] 步骤S20根据分别接收到的开锁数据,判断所述地图图片中的用户运动轨迹是否相同;
[0057] 步骤S30若所述地图图片中的用户运动轨迹相同,则发送门锁开启指令;
[0058] 步骤S31若所述地图图片中的用户运动轨迹不同,则放弃发送门锁开启指令;
[0059] 优选的,还包括步骤S40根据分别接收到的开锁数据,判断所述开锁数据中的特征信息与预设移动终端所对应的特征信息是否相同;
[0060] 优选的,还包括步骤S41若所述开锁数据中的特征信息与预设移动终端所对应的特征信息相同,则跳转至步骤S50;否则,结束开锁过程;
[0061] 步骤S50根据已发送的门锁开启指令,执行门锁开启操作。
[0062] 图5是本发明一种门锁控制系统的组成结构示意图。如图5所示,根据本发明的一个实施例,一种基于移动终端的门锁控制系统,包括移动终端10和门锁装置20,[0063] 优选的,所述移动终端10包括设置模块11,在所述设置模块11中至少预设用户运动轨迹所经过的一个地理位置,和/或预设移动终端所对应的特征信息,例如:公司所在的地理位置、家附近的某个超市所在的地理位置,例如手机的识别码(手机IMEI号);
[0064] 优选的,所述移动终端10还包括采集记录模块12,所述采集记录模块12解析用户的操作,采集记录含有用户运动轨迹的地图图片;
[0065] 所述移动终端10包括第一网络子模块13和第二网络子模块14,所述门锁装置20包括第一网络子子模块21和第二网络子子模块22;
[0066] 所述第一网络子模块13与所述第一网络子子模块21通讯连接,所述第一网络子模块13向所述第一网络子子模块21传输开锁数据,所述开锁数据包括含有用户运动轨迹的地图图片和上传所述开锁数据的移动终端所对应的特征信息;
[0067] 所述第二网络子模块14与所述第二网络子子模块22通讯连接,所述第二网络子模块14向所述第二网络子子模块22传输所述开锁数据;
[0068] 所述门锁装置20还包括判断模块23、控制模块24和执行模块25,
[0069] 所述判断模块23根据所述第一网络子子模块21和第二网络子子模块22接收到的开锁数据,判断所述地图图片中的用户运动轨迹是否相同;
[0070] 所述控制模块24接收所述判断模块23输出的所述地图图片中的用户运动轨迹相同,则发送门锁开启指令;否则,放弃发送门锁开启指令;
[0071] 所述执行模块25接收所述控制模块24发出的门锁开启指令,执行门锁开启操作。
[0072] 根据本发明的另一个实施例,一种基于移动终端的门锁控制系统,包括移动终端10和门锁装置20,
[0073] 所述移动终端10包括设置模块11,至少预设用户运动轨迹所经过的一个地理位置,和预设移动终端所对应的特征信息,例如:公司所在的地理位置、家附近的某个超市所在的地理位置,例如手机的识别码(手机IMEI号);
[0074] 所述移动终端10还包括采集记录模块12,解析用户的操作,采集记录含有用户运动轨迹的地图图片;
[0075] 所述门锁装置20还包括获取模块,获取上传所述开锁数据的移动终端所对应的特征信息;
[0076] 所述移动终端10包括第一网络子模块13和第二网络子模块14,所述门锁装置20包括第一网络子子模块21和第二网络子子模块22;
[0077] 所述第一网络子模块13与所述第一网络子子模块21通讯连接,所述第一网络子模块13向所述第一网络子子模块21传输开锁数据,所述开锁数据包括含有用户运动轨迹的地图图片和上传所述开锁数据的移动终端所对应的特征信息;
[0078] 所述第二网络子模块14与所述第二网络子子模块22通讯连接,所述第二网络子模块14向所述第二网络子子模块22传输所述开锁数据;
[0079] 所述门锁装置20还包括判断模块23,判断所述地图图片中的用户运动轨迹是否相同;
[0080] 若所述地图图片中的用户运动轨迹相同,则判断模块23还进一步判断所述地图图片中的用户运动轨迹是否经过预设地理位置;否则,放弃发送门锁开启指令;
[0081] 所述门锁装置20还包括控制模块24,若所述地图图片中的用户运动轨迹经过预设地理位置,则发送门锁开启指令;否则,放弃发送门锁开启指令;
[0082] 所述判断模块23还根据分别接收到的开锁数据,判断所述开锁数据中的特征信息与预设移动终端所对应的特征信息是否相同;
[0083] 所述门锁装置20还包括执行模块25,若所述开锁数据中的特征信息与预设移动终端所对应的特征信息相同,则执行模块25根据已发送的门锁开启指令,执行门锁开启操作;否则,结束开锁过程。
[0084] 优选的,所述第一网络子模块、第一网络子子模块均为移动网络模块或WIFI无线网络模块;所述第二网络子模块、第二网络子子模块均为蓝牙无线网络模块或红外无线网络模块;所述控制模块24为微处理器;所述执行模块25包括PLC控制器模块、电磁阀;除了上述模块,所述门锁装置20还包括光电转换模块、数据寄存器、电源模块。
[0085] 根据本发明的一个实施例,一种基于移动终端的门锁控制方法,包括:将电子锁安装在房门上,电子锁包括CPU控制单元模块、WIFI传输模块、WIFI接收模块、红外接收、光电转换模块、数据寄存器、比较器模块、PLC控制器模块、电磁阀、气动元件模块和电源模块;
[0086] 在手机上安装一个“采集用户运动轨迹实现开门锁”软件,该软件是基于手机GPS定位自动采集记录获取用户运动轨迹的地图图片数据信息并发送传输指令;
[0087] 将安装在房门上的电子锁插接通电源后,该电子锁处于工作状态;电子锁上的WIFI传输模块和WIFI接收模块自动连接上用户家中的WIFI网络;主要是通过WIFI网络接收用户手机传送过来的关于用户运动轨迹的地图图片数据信息;
[0088] 当用户外出时,用户先打开手机上的“基于用户运动轨迹实现开门锁”的软件后,点击“开始”按钮,软件便开始连续的采集记录用户的运动轨迹数据;
[0089] 当用户外出回来到达房门口时,用户点击软件中的“结束”按钮,软件停止采集记录数据,并将所采集记录关于用户此次出去的所有连续的运动轨迹以地图图片的数据信息形式输出给手机,并通过手机网络,再传送给用户房门上的电子锁,并存储到数据寄存器和比较器模块中;
[0090] 用户再将手机上的红外发射端对准电子锁的红外接收端,用户再点击软件中“开锁”按钮后,软件便将所采集记录的用户所有运动轨迹地图图片数据信息通过手机红外功能传输给房门上的特定电子锁,电子锁在收到手机传送来的用户运动轨迹的地图图片信息后;
[0091] 通过数据比较器模块与电子锁内部的寄存器中存储的用户手机IMEI号进行比较分析,如果寄存器中有相同的手机IMEI号,电子锁便认定用户手机IMEI号验证通过;
[0092] CPU控制单元模块向PLC控制器发出验证通过的数据信息,PLC控制器在收到信息后便开始运行相关的PLC程序指令,控制电磁阀和气动元件模块的工作状态是关闭还是开启,气动元件是控制电子锁锁栓推出和拉进的直接动力,气动元件关闭,电子锁锁栓拉进,此时用户家的房门便可以打开;启动元件开启,电子锁锁栓推出,此时用户家的房门便被锁住。
[0093] 本发明具有安全等级度高、保密性比较好、使用方便、简单易操作等优点。
[0094] 应当说明的是,上述实施例均可根据需要自由组合。以上所述仅是本发明的优选实施方式,应当指出,对于本技术领域的普通技术人员来说,在不脱离本发明原理的前提下,还可以做出若干改进和润饰,这些改进和润饰也应视为本发明的保护范围。